I ran into this myself, however, I had 10 disks (5 per channel) and one chennel went down. Ok, my array was dead at that point and I had to reboot. What luck, the arry wasn't usable anymore. My /usr was on that array, but my / was not. I did not want to go through the initrd/initramfs thing at the time to setup my / with raid5, plus the fact you truely cannot boot from it (thus partitioning and setting aside a slice wasn't viable to me) > RAID-HOWTO lists some actions that can be done in this case, but none of > them can be done if root filesystem is on RAID --- the machine just won't > boot. I had to reconstruct the array by hand with mdadm. evms wouldn't touch it. Fortunately, I had a copy of each disk's information and the raid5's information in files so it was quite easy to rebuild. I did have backups but that wasn't really what I wanted to do. (It did take over 2 hours before I could return to normal. evms can't handle a raid5 that was in reconstruction. I think newer versions have this fixed.) > I think Linux should stop accessing all disks in RAID-5 array if two disks > fail and not write "this array is dead" in superblocks on remaining disks, > efficiently destroying the whole array.
